Jarvis passed away on February 4th, at St. Joseph’s Hospital at Comox BC. Born in Sydney, Nova Scotia on October 15th, 1990.

We are extremely sad to announce the sudden passing of Jarvis Alexander Simon (Jarvie). Jarvis was a quiet compassionate young man, who chartered his own course through life. He expressed himself in many ways through his phenomenal writing, drawing and cooking. Jarvie was undecided in what he wanted to do with his life, but he wanted a career and not just a job. His favourite thing in life (besides gaming) was the Great Outdoors. He was an accomplished scout, and firestarter (he could make a fire in the pouring rain). His loving nature came through in his relationships with his family, friends, and his pets. He will be sorely missed by all who knew Jarvis. His memory of his gentle ways, and beautiful smile will live forever strong in our hearts.

Predeceased by his grandmother Jean Simon, Sydney, NS.

Survived by his loving parents James and Tammy, and Darlene and John, his siblings, Chester, Becky, Benjamin, Ruel-Dawn and Jade. His loving grandparents Billie and Josie. His uncles Troy-Darryl, Eugene, Aunt Tracey and his wonderful cousins.

A Celebration of Life will be held on February 20th at 11am at the Halbe Hall. If you choose to donate, donations to the BC Children’s Hospital would be appreciated.
